Pride Bodies Ltd., a Wabtec Company in Cambridge, Ontario, offers custom design and truck-body manufacturing and upfitting of utility, service, construction, railway and other custom truck bodies. Our environmentally-friendly truck bodies are researched, designed and customized to our customers’ satisfaction.

Who will you be working with?

As a member of the team at Pride Bodies Ltd., you will be working daily in the Welding Department with the Welding Supervisor and a group of approximately 8 other Welders.

What do we want to know about you?

  • High School / GED diploma required;
  • Maintain regular and reliable attendance;
  • Stamina and strength to perform manual labour; eagerness to learn on the job;
  • Certified or willing to obtain CWB certification in aluminum and steel;
  • Able to read blue-print drawings and interpret them along with weld symbols;
  • Experience in welding / fabrication and fitting skills in aluminum and steel;
  • Able to read tape measure correctly;
  • Able to learn quickly and progress at a reasonable pace;
  • Troubleshoot problems and take corrective action;
  • Work with Supervisor and Engineering to prototype new designs;
  • Be team focused and task oriented;
  • What will your typical day look like?

  • Understand instructions and carry them out efficiently within the given deadline;
  • Apply safe automotive / manufacturing work practices and become familiar with equipment (saw, drill press, iron worker, welding machine);
  • Read and understand shop drawings to enable independent work;
  • Set up and maintain shop tools and equipment; learn to set up and maintain new tools and equipment as required;
  • Use overhead and gantry cranes efficiently and safely and exhibit safe rigging practices;
  • MIG (steel and aluminum) and manual plasma cut;
  • Set up welding machines to weld different thicknesses of material;
  • Ensure work is tacked, squared and correct to the drawings before completing welds;
  • Take all work order packages from start to finish with minimal assistance (aluminum and steel) in a timely manner;
  • Document material usage and scrap correctly;
  • Stack parts for easy access for the next operation and label both parts and skids / containers correctly.
  • Assist in other areas of production as needed, if qualified.
